Abstract
Data within database and/or spreadsheet programs of a first computer system are made recognizable by a second computer system. The recognizable data serves to facilitate either data processing within the first computer system by instructions received from the second computer system and/or to transfer the recognizable data of the first computer system to the database and/or spreadsheet program of the second computer system for subsequent processing by the second computer system.

3. A method for integrating information between databases comprising:
-
sampling data from a first database;
procuring data processing instructions from a second database;
configuring the sampled data within the first database into a form recognizable by the processing instructions of the second database;
executing the data processing instructions of the second database on the sampled and configured data to generate processing results;
transferring the processing results to the second database; and
if transfer is successful,processing the remainder of the data from the first database by the same procedure used for the sampled data. - View Dependent Claims (4)
